    WHAT IS BLOOD PRESSURE? WHAT IS BLOOD PRESSURE? What is Blood Pressure? Systolic Pressure Blood Pressure is the force exerted on the walls of your blood vessels as blood flows through them. Your heart is like a pump. When it contracts, or beats, it sends a surge of blood through the blood vessels and the pressure increases.
